All data-bearing devices undergo certified secure data destruction to industry standards. We use software wiping to NCSC CPA standards, physical destruction, or degaussing depending on your requirements. You receive full certification documenting the destruction of every device, including serial numbers.

WEEE (Waste Electrical and Electronic Equipment) regulations require businesses to dispose of IT equipment through approved recycling facilities. Non-compliance can result in substantial fines and environmental damage. We are fully WEEE-compliant, ensuring your equipment is processed legally and responsibly with zero waste to landfill.

After secure data destruction, equipment is sorted by material type. Components containing precious metals (gold, silver, copper) are recovered. Plastics, steel, and aluminium are separated for recycling. Hazardous materials are processed by licensed specialists. We achieve zero waste to landfill, with detailed reporting on disposal routes and environmental impact.

What We Don't Collect (And Where to Take It)

While we recycle all business IT equipment, there are some items we cannot accept due to licensing restrictions or safety regulations:

❌ Items We Cannot Collect:

  • Consumer Electronics from Households: TVs, home stereos, domestic appliances (use your local council recycling center)
  • White Goods: Fridges, washing machines, microwaves (require specialist F-Gas certified disposal)
  • Medical Equipment: Patient monitoring devices, diagnostic equipment (require specialist clinical waste disposal)
  • Hazardous Materials: Batteries (bulk loose), damaged lithium batteries, chemical waste
  • Non-WEEE Items: Furniture, paper, general office waste (arrange with commercial waste provider)

βœ… Where to Recycle Consumer Items:

  • Home Computers/Laptops: Local council household waste recycling centers (HWRCs) accept these free of charge
  • Small Electronics: Many retailers (Currys, John Lewis, etc.) offer free take-back schemes for old electronics
  • Mobile Phones: Mobile network shops offer free recycling, or donate to charity for reuse programs
  • Batteries: Supermarkets and retailers have battery recycling bins at entrances

Why Proper IT Equipment Identification Matters

Correctly identifying and categorizing your IT equipment before recycling ensures compliance, proper valuation, and efficient processing:

πŸ”’ Data Security

Different devices require different data destruction methods. Hard drives need physical shredding, SSDs require specialized erasure, and mobile devices need secure wiping protocols.

♻️ Environmental Compliance

WEEE regulations classify equipment into different categories (IT/telecom, large equipment, etc.). Proper classification ensures legal disposal and accurate compliance reporting.

πŸ’° Asset Recovery

Working equipment has resale value. Identifying functional assets vs. scrap means you could receive payment through our IT buyback service instead of paying for disposal.

πŸ“‹ Audit Trails

Accurate equipment inventories enable detailed asset reporting with serial numbers, models, and destruction methods – essential for ISO audits and compliance.

Do you recycle equipment with hazardous materials?

Yes, IT equipment often contains hazardous materials (lead in solder, mercury in displays, etc.). Our Environment Agency licensed facility is authorized to handle these safely. We separate and process hazardous components through specialist channels, ensuring legal and safe disposal.
